Download Conexant Audio Drivers Manually
If you want, you can download the latest Conexant Audio driver manually. While Conexant offers many amazing audio and voice-enabled products for sound systems (such as Conexant HD SmartAudio) and computer peripherals, it doesn’t offer Conexant audio drivers on its official website.
So, there’s no point in searching for the latest Conexant audio driver on Conexant website. Instead you should go to your laptop or desktop manufacturer’s website and search for the compatible SmartAudio HD driver. For example, if you use a Dell laptop, then you should go Dell official site and download the latest Conexant audio driver from there. Similarly Lenovo and Acer users can get the drivers from their PC manufacturer’s site.
